CHAPTER 1.1 PEOPLE INTERPRETATION OF RECYCLING
The
most reason why people do not recycle is because people think that
recycling is inconvenient. People do not bother to recycle as it is a
waste of time and effort.
Another
reason is the mindset of people have, which is that rewards should be
given for recycling. Some countries like Singapore have no penalties or
incentives for recycling causing them not to have a practice or
recycling. Unlike like Japan, they will be reward or those who recycle.
For example, bottle recycling, the cost of the bottle will be return
back if it is being recycled into the recycling machine. Which cause a
great significant impact on the number of people who recycle and also
the practice of recycling.
Most
of the people think that there are not have enough space in their homes
to recycle. They think that it is an eyesore to place the recycled
stuff in their homes. Based on research, the lack of space is a big
issue to many.
There
are a lot of misinformation about overflowing landfills, depleted
resources and climate change that has convinced people's mindset that
recycling does not make any differences.
Recycling
is a big problem as many do not have the habit to do it. Many
Singaporeans do not have the habit of recycling, they tend to just dump
everything into the bin and just dispose it. Many have the mindset that
it does not make a difference if they recycle or not.
CHAPTER 1.2 THE IMPORTANCE OF RECYCLING
Recycling
saves energy when using recycled materials. Energy consumption will be
reduced and also production costs is being reduced.
Recycling reduces the need for more landfills which also save spaces for other uses.
Recycling
preserves resources and protects wildlife. For example like recycling
paper, trees are saved and habitats will not be destroyed. Thus,
wildlife creatures and animals will not be homeless.
Recycling
is good for the economy and also reduce climate problems. By recycling
and purchasing recycled products causes a good practice for the earth
and the economy. Recycled Goods made from recycled materials use lesser
water which uses lesser energy and creates less pollution. Recycling
reduces the amount of unhealthy greenhouse gas omissions which leads to
lesser risk of air pollution.
